HomeMy WebLinkAbout030-2066-20-000(3) April 2, 2007 File: LU0066 Matt Sklar 165 Riverview Acres Road Hudson, WI 54016 Re: Land Use Permit,Lower St. Croix Riverway District Parcel#: 35.30.20.608C,Town of St.Joseph Dear Mr. Sklar: Thank you for your submittals to date including photographs of your property as viewed from the river, proposed vegetation management plan, and draft affidavit. I have reviewed these materials and still require the following information: • Condition#1 of your land use permit states that you must submit a compliance deposit prior to commencing construction. We have not received this deposit. • Condition#2 of your land use permit states that the vegetation management plan must encompass the area along the top of the slope preservation zone and within 40 feet of the bluffline between the principal structure and the river. Within this area, you must plant native trees,shrubs,and groundcover to ensure that the existing principal structure,trellis, and proposed roof alterations are visually inconspicuous in their entirety from the St. Croix River and to comply with the vegetation standards in Sections 17.36 H.8 and 17.36 I.5.c.1)of the Ordinance. In reviewing the photographs, it appears that your residence and proposed alterations will be visually inconspicuous from the river. However,the vegetation management plan does not include native vegetation within 40 feet of the bluffline, does not include additional trees and shrubs, and does not meet the vegetation standards in Section 17.36 H.B. of the Ordinance. Section 17.36 H.8 provides that, in addition to screening structures, vegetation in the Riverway District shall be managed with the goals of preventing disturbance of environmentally sensitive areas such as steep slopes and bluff top areas, maintaining and restoring historically and ecologically significant plant communities and enhancing diversity, and maintaining and restoring native ground cover, understory, and overstory. The vegetation plan does not currently meet all of these goals. You must submit a revised plan that incorporates additional native trees, shrubs, and groundcover. Additionally,the plan must be more detailed to show the location, number/density, size, and species of existing and proposed trees, shrubs, and groundcover along the top of the slope preservation zone and within 40 feet of the bluffline. Since the residence appears to be screened from the river,you may reduce the density of trees originally required as part of this condition. I would be happy to meet with you to determine an appropriate number and placement of trees and shrubs to meet the goals of the Ordinance. • Condition#3 of your land use permit states that you must record an affidavit against your property referencing the approved vegetation plan. The draft affidavit that you submitted looks good. Once your revised vegetation plan is approved,you must record it with the St. Croix County Register of Deeds. Please contact me if you would like to schedule a meeting to discuss these conditions. If you wish to appeal staff decisions on any of these matters, you may do so by filing with the Zoning Administrator and the St. Croix County Board of Adjustment a notice of appeal specifying the grounds thereof. This notice of appeal must be filed within a reasonable time and will require a public hearing pursuant to Section 17.70(6)of the St. Croix County Zoning Ordinance. Sincerely, Jenny Shillcox Land Use Specialist/Zoning Administrator Cc: Clerk, Town of St. Joseph Kevin Grabau, St. Croix County Code Administrator Steve Olson, St. Croix County Land and Water Conservation Department Dan Baumann,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ources I March 13,2007 File: LU0066 Matt Sklar 165 Riverview Acres Road Hudson, WI 54016 Re: Land Use Permit,Lower St. Croix Riverway District Parcel#35.30.20.608C,Town of St.Joseph Dear Mr. Sklar: This letter confirms zoning approval to alter and expand an existing principal structure in the Lower St. Croix Riverway District in the Town of St. Joseph pursuant to Section 17.36 F.2.a.1 of the St. Croix County Zoning Ordinance. The existing 3,481-square foot structure is located over 200 feet from the Ordinary High Water Mark (OHWM) of the St. Croix River and approximately 60 feet from the bluffline at its closest point. The height of the existing structure is approximately 30 feet. The alterations and expansion approved as part of this land use permit include removing a deck on the riverward side of the structure and replacing it with a trellis; overlaying the existing hip roof to create full-height gables; raising one section of the roof over the existing dining room, vestibule, and entry to match the roof height of the upper floor bedrooms; installing a new covered entry on the landward side of the structure; and installing a new walkway to this entry. Additional work proposed as part of this project that does not require a County land use permit but still requires a Town building permit includes installing new windows and siding, and re-roofing the entire structure. Staff finds that the request meets the requirements of the St. Croix County Zoning Ordinance and the Lower St. Croix Riverway District based on the following findings: 1. The property is located in the Rural Residential Management Zone of the Lower St. Croix Riverway District; 2. No filling and grading will occur on slopes over 12 percent or within 40 feet of the bluffline. Only minimal filling and grading is proposed to install footings for the proposed covered entry and to install the walkway on the landward side of the principal structure; 3. The proposed trellis,covered entry,and walkway will add less than 100 square feet of impervious coverage to the site since they will replace existing impervious coverage; 4. The proposed roof alterations will not increase the height of the existing principal structure; 5. The existing principal structure and proposed trellis,entry and walkway all meet the 200-foot setback from OHWM of the St. Croix River; 6. The existing principal structure and proposed trellis do not meet the 100-foot setback from the bluffline and the majority of native vegetation along the top of the slope preservation zone and within 40 feet of the bluffline has been cleared. Since both structures are located over 40 feet from the bluffline,the principal structure may be altered and expanded and the trellis may be constructed provided the finished structures do not protrude above the bluffline,utilize building materials that are earth tone in color and non-reflective,and are made visually inconspicuous with native tree and shrub plantings pursuant to Section 17.36 G.5.c.2.a)of the Ordinance; 7. With conditions for planting additional native trees, shrubs, and groundcover along the top of the slope preservation zone and within the 40-foot bluffline setback area,the existing principal structure and proposed trellis and roof alterations will not be visually conspicuous from the St. Croix River and the property will be brought into compliance with the current standards in the Lower St. Croix Riverway District; 8. The existing principal structure features brown, earth tone siding and shingles. With conditions for finishing all improvements in earth tone colors,the structure will blend in with the natural surroundings; 9. The proposed covered entry and walkway will be located on the landward side of the existing principal structure and will not be visible from the river; 10. The St. Croix County Land and Water Conservation Department has reviewed the plans and visited the site and recommends that, as a condition of this permit,native vegetation be re-established in the slope preservation zone to provide screening; 11. The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ources has reviewed the plans and does not object to the approval of this permit;and 12. With the conditions stipulated above,this project will meet the spirit and intent of the Lower St. Croix Riverway District since it will not degrade the scenic,recreational,or natural values of the St. Croix River Valley,and will not negatively affect the public health,safety and welfare of County residents. Approval of the land use permit is subject to the following conditions: 1. Prior to commencing construction,the applicant shall submit a Compliance Deposit in the amount of $300 to be held by the Zoning Administrator until all conditions have been completed and approved, at which time it will be refunded in full pursuant to Section 17.36 J.8 of the Ordinance. 2. Prior to commencing construction,the applicant shall submit to and have approved by the Zoning Administrator a vegetation management plan for the top of the slope preservation zone and the area and the river. Within this area the applicant within 40 feet of the bluffline between the principal structure pp structure,trellis and shall plant native trees, shrubs, and groundcover to ensure that the existing st , roof alterations are visually inconspicuous in their entirety from the St. Croix River and to proposed Y P Y comply with the vegetation standards in Sections 17.36 H.8 and 17.36 1.5.c.1) of the Ordinance. All trees within this area shall be at least two inches Diameter at Breast Height(DBH)and planted no more than 12 feet apart and staggered parallel to the river and the structure. As part of the plan,the applicant shall III include some faster growing trees species to provide immediate screening as the slower growing species g g p P g g g P reach maturity, and shall agree to allow the area along the top of the bluff to regenerate naturally and not to dump grass clippings and branches down the slopes,which can hinder the growth of native vegetation and contribute to nutrient runoff into the St. Croix River. This vegetation management plan shall be implemented immediately upon completing construction(as weather allows). 3. Within 14 days of approval of the vegetation management plan,the applicant shall record an affidavit with the Register of Deeds referencing the plan and provide a recorded copy to the Zoning Administrator pursuant to Section 17.361.5.c.4)of the Ordinance. The purpose of this is to alert future property owners of the responsibilities and limitations incurred by the plan. 4. The finished principal structure shall be no taller than 35 feet in height pursuant to Section 17.36 G.4.a.1) of the Ordinance. 5. All siding, shingles,trim, and other appurtenances of the structure and the new roof shall be earth tone in color and of a non-reflective nature(except for windows) so as not to be visually conspicuous from the St. Croix River pursuant to Sections 17.36 G.5.c.2)a)and 17.36 H.l of the Ordinance. 6. Within 30 days of substantially completing the proposed expansion,the applicant shall submit to the Zoning Administrator certification from the project engineer or architect that the height of the structure does not exceed 35 feet, as well as photos of the completed construction and vegetation plantings as viewed from the bluffline and the river. 7. All activities approved as part of this land use permit shall commence within one year from the date of approval and be substantially completed within two years,after which time the permit expires pursuant to Section 17.36 J.7 of the Ordinance. Prior to expiration, the applicant may request extensions of up to six months from the Zoning Administrator. The total time granted for extensions shall not exceed one year. 8. Failure to comply with the conditions above may result in the revocation of this permit pursuant to Section 17.36 J.8.b of the Ordinance. This approval does not allow for any construction beyond the limits of this request. Your information will remain on file in the St. Croix County Planning and Zoning Department. You must contact the Town of St. Joseph to obtain a building permit. It is your responsibility to ensure compliance with any other local, state, and federal rules or regulations.
